Same name and namespace in other branches
  1. 8.9.x core/lib/Drupal/Core/Entity/EntityTypeInterface.php \Drupal\Core\Entity\EntityTypeInterface::getUriCallback()
  2. 9 core/lib/Drupal/Core/Entity/EntityTypeInterface.php \Drupal\Core\Entity\EntityTypeInterface::getUriCallback()

Gets a callable that can be used to provide the entity URI.

This is only called if there is no matching link template for the link relationship type, and there is no bundle-specific callback provided.

Return value

callable|null A valid callback that is passed the entity or NULL if none is specified.

1 method overrides EntityTypeInterface::getUriCallback()
EntityType::getUriCallback in core/lib/Drupal/Core/Entity/EntityType.php
Gets a callable that can be used to provide the entity URI.

File

core/lib/Drupal/Core/Entity/EntityTypeInterface.php, line 665

Class

EntityTypeInterface
Provides an interface for an entity type and its metadata.

Namespace

Drupal\Core\Entity

Code

public function getUriCallback();